Process Flow - mapping not inserting data

I have a process flow that executes three mappings in sequence i.e Map1 -> Map2 -> Map3.
However, sometimes the process flow will execute and no data will be inserted by MAP2, other times it runs ok. If I run the mappings directly data is always inserted.
The only workaround I've found is to add a WAIT of 10sec between Map1 and Map2 in the process flow.
Has anyone come across anything like this and how did you work around or fix it?
OWB 10.2.0.3 btw.
Cheers
Si
PS. transitions are ok.

Hi
If you have any map inputs make sure they are also declared in the processflow map - you basicly need to bind them.
You probably need to investigate from the beginning to understand your result of incoherent data.
What I would to first is.
1. Generete an intermediete code - choose your table as outgroup.
2. Review the code - are there any loading hints ?
3. Debug the map
Check your locations.
If everything seems right then the problem should lay on your workflow manager.
Remember that the workflow manager has only one namespace, so watchout for mapping name. I had strange executions on my PF because one of my maps had a "½" in the name.
Check the settings of the map - if you have enterd a set based run in your map and a row based run in the processflow.
Remember the setting in the processflow is the "superior" one
Just ideas what you can do.

  • Process flow/map performance issues

    We have some issues with our OWB-based application and we're looking to find out if there are different ways we could be using the tool, or features/options we've missed.
    We are trying to maintain a near real time feed of data from a front end system into our warehouse which was built using OWB 10.2.0.3 over a 10.2.0.4 database. The bulk of the application consists of OWB maps with a few hand-written PL/SQL objects, all executed in a series of hierachical OWB process flows. Maps/transformations are executed either sequentially or in parallel where the referential integrity of the model allows.
    The problem is that we have around 150 tables in the datamart which could potentially require updating on each refresh cycle, although in practice only a few tables have any activity on a typical refresh cycle. The cycle consists of loading data into a set of staging tables, and from there the data is transformed into the main schema, often with multiple maps per target table.
    On every cycle we run hundreds of maps, the vast majority of which process zero rows. Each map runs quickly and efficiently in its own right but collectively they add up to a 5 - 10 min cycle even if there is no data to process.
    There are 2 avenues which we'd like to explore and would be grateful if anyone could provide any pointers/suggestions :-
    1) It appears that each map opens and closes its own database session when it executes. I presume this was done because a single process flow could be constructed with maps executing in different target schemas, but we know that's not the case for us. We'd like to know if there is anyway to configure the database connection at a higher level (eg. process flow) so it opens a connection once and executes each of the maps (database packages) in that one session.
    Our DBAs are experimenting with 'shared server' settings at a database level which may help to some degree but won't be the whole story.
    2) Another option is simply to run less maps eg. load the staging area as now, collate stats on which staging tables contain new data, and then apply some logic such that subsequent maps only execute if the relevant staging table(s) contain(s) some new data, otherwise bypass that map.
    We tried experimenting with the 'Pre Mapping Process' operator, but essentially that just generates another function call from the map package, so we still have the overhead of opening a database session for each map to run the package. Minimal gain.
    We thought about adding a function call in the process flow before each map and then branching to either execute/bypass the map as approriate, but the function call still requires opening/closing of a database session each time so, once again, minimal gain.
    What we really want is some way for a map or process flow to check without logging onto the database repeatedly.
    Any ideas on the above, or other potential solutions anyone could suggest, would be greatly appreciated.

  • Function to call Process-flows/mapping from SQL

    Hi All,
    Can any one of you send me the function to call process-flows/mappings (eg: I have 10 mapping/Process-flows). It is an urgent requirement pending in my final testing.
    Plz help me in this regard.
    Regards

    Hi
    All information that you need, you can find in $ORACLE_HOME/owb/rtp/sql/. BAsically all executions in owb is called through wb_rt_api_exec package.
    for example:
    declare
         variable exec_return_code number;
         procesflow varchar2(255);
    plsqlname varchar2(255);
    begin
    -- Initialize Return Code
    exec_return_code := owbrt_sys.wb_rt_api_exec.RESULT_FAILURE;
    -- Run Task
    procesflow:='WF_X1';
    plsqlname:='MP_X1'
    exec_return_code := owbrt_sys.wb_rt_api_exec.run_task('OWF_LCTN','PROCESS',procesflow, ' ' );
    if exec_return_code = 1 then
    exec_return_code := owbrt_sys.wb_rt_api_exec.run_task('STAGE_LCTN','PLSQL',plsqlname, ' ' );
    end if;
    end;

  • Scheduled process flows are not running automaticaly-OWB database clonning

    What I did:
    1.     Cloned the entire OWB repository database from live (bidb01.bh.xyz.com) server to new (green1.bh.xyz.com) server.
    ******     Source     New
    Physical Hostname     bidb01.bh.xyz.com     green1.bh.xyz.com
    DB Logical Hostname     xyzbidb      bidb-lh
    Service Name     BIPROD     BIPROD
    Listener Port     1521     1521
    Oracle Home of RDBMS     /app/oracle/home/product/10.2.0     /orabidb/oracle/product/10.2.0
    Oracle Home of OWB     /app/oracle/home/product/10.2.0/owb /orabidb/oracle/product/10.2.0/owb
    2.     Followed the Metalink Note 434272.1 (How To Update Warehouse Builder After A Database Cloning)
    Issue:
    Before doing the step-2, every time we put the new database up the normal process flows which run every day (10 AM, 1 AM , 2 AM , 2 PM, etc.) got executed on the production environment and hung the original processes that are being run on the production environment.
    After following the note 434272, scheduled process flows in production is working fine but in the new server it is not at all working.
    Could anyone please help me to fix this?
    Edited by: Padmanaban G on May 7, 2010 5:15 PM

    The issue was resolved by renaming the workflow. What is learned here is, we should not have same workflow name for two different workspace.
